But I&#8217;ve really just been focusing on me, just working on my craft this offseason, just trying to be consistent, and also just taking my game to another level, whether that&#8217; s on the field, in the classroom, just trying to have a bigger role this year within the D-line and on the team.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>If Murphy is going to take his game to another level in Year 2, it will in part be because of the natural growth that often occurs following a rookie season, but it could also come from him being in more situations to make plays in the backfield. After playing a lot of nose tackle as a rookie, Murphy said he is expecting see more time as a three-technique defensive tackle this year, meaning he would be lined up between a guard and tackle rather than across from center. That three-technique role is one that traditionally comes with more pass-rush opportunities.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;I&#8217;ll be playing a lot of 3-tech this year, a lot more, way more than I did last year, so I&#8217;m going to have way more opps at 3-tech as far as pass rush and everything, getting the opportunity to rush,&#8221; he said.<\/p>\n<p>And ultimately, the best way for Murphy to get more pass-rush opportunities in an interior group that also includes Reed and Leonard Williams, one of the game&#8217;s best interior rushers who had 11 sacks last season, is for the Seahawks to dominate on early downs to create more pass-rush situations.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;We&#8217;ll create more pass rushing opportunities for our defense and he&#8217;ll be right there,&#8221; Seahawks coach Mike Macdonald said. &#8220;We have to play better on early downs to create those situations.
